The construction framework in Colombia is governed by the NSR-10 (Norma Sismo Resistente) structural code, demanding structural components—including expansion joints, window-to-wall sealants, and structural glazing elements—to accommodate severe structural shifts. Concurrently, the rise of modern commercial facades, high-rise office towers, and localized industrial warehouses requires sealing materials with long-term elastic recovery. In cities like Bogotá, situated 2,640 meters above sea level, materials are exposed to constant, aggressive solar ultraviolet rays which easily degrade low-quality, plasticizer-heavy compounds. In contrast, coastal cities like Cartagena and Barranquilla demand anti-corrosive, salt-water-resistant properties.
This geographic diversity means a one-size-fits-all product is bound to fail. Our product engineering addresses this directly by stabilizing polymer backbones with high-grade UV absorbers and antioxidants, ensuring that structural and weatherproofing sealants maintain their elasticity and bond strength for decades, rather than failing prematurely and risking water infiltration.

Representing the next stage of sealing technology, MS Polymers combine the positive weatherability characteristics of silicones with the high mechanical performance and paintability of polyurethanes. Being completely free of solvents, isocyanates, and silicone oils, they prevent surface staining on porous materials like natural stone, granite, and marble—a critical concern for premium commercial projects in Colombia's municipal centers.

Our architectural silicone sealants and MS Polymers are formulated with high-quality ultraviolet absorbers and hindred amine light stabilizers (HALS). This prevents polymer chain degradation, cracking, or color fading, even under the intense solar radiation typical of Colombia's high-altitude regions.
Yes. Our structural silicones and polyurethane joint sealants are designed to meet or exceed ISO 11600 and ASTM C920 standards, which specify the movement capabilities required for seismic joint sealing and structural expansions under NSR-10.
